Quote:
Originally Posted by Day Tripper View Post
how do you take a screen shot with your laptop???
Two ways:

1) Press Print Screen button... it should be at the top after the F12 key. Then paste the screenshot into Paint or something and save it.

2) Open the search bar/cortana and type "Snipping Tool" and open that. Lets you choose a selection to capture and then you can save it. I think there's a full screen option.
